Address 0 MONA

MEwfPRXiNEvg2xVAy8TKbZD8A1eqGn8oFf

Confirmed

Total Received44.10239031 MONA
Total Sent44.10239031 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MEwfPRXiNEvg2xVAy8TKbZD8A1eqGn8oFf44.10239031 MONA
Fee: 0 MONA
3886814 Confirmations44.10239031 MONA
MEwfPRXiNEvg2xVAy8TKbZD8A1eqGn8oFf44.10239031 MONA
MWT8rQYMZFGWtHpHaCBngxm9U3ADuuk3ca1.30654392 MONA
Fee: 0.001 MONA
3886835 Confirmations45.40893423 MONA